50 votes

Comment désactiver le comptage automatique des références Xcode4.2

Aujourd'hui, j'ai mis à jour mon xCode vers la version 4.2, et je veux désactiver l'ARC, je recherche aussi avec Google. mais ne peut pas résoudre mon problème. Selon les résultats de la recherche, je ne parviens pas à trouver l'élément "Comptage de référence automatique Objective-C" dans la configuration cible. Par conséquent, je n'ai aucune chance de le définir sur NO. Je trouve l’objet un à un et utilise également le champ de recherche.

Et on connaît le dernier Xcode4.2, comment désactiver l'ARC pour le projet, pas pour le fichier spécifique.

Merci beaucoup.

109voto

NJones Points 20265
  • Cliquez sur votre projet dans l'agenda de gauche.
  • Sélectionnez votre cible, dans la colonne suivante.
  • Sélectionnez l'onglet Paramètres de construction en haut.
  • Faites défiler jusqu'à "Comptage automatique de références Objective-C" (il peut être répertorié sous "CLANG_ENABLE_OBJC_ARC" dans le groupe de paramètres défini par l' utilisateur ),
  • et réglez-le sur NO.

C'est sur Xcode 4.2 (Build 4D199).

1voto

alex gray Points 5089

Dans Xcode 4.2 beta, il y avait 2 places par cible que vous pourriez alterner l'utilisation de l'ARC... maintenant, il semble n'y en avoir AUCUN.

Aussi, le "Convertir à l'ARC" dans le menu semble avoir disparu.

Maintenant, oui, je suppose que l'ARC de choses n'a jamais été conçu pour les Développeurs Mac, comme 4.2 beta était seulement sur iOS, mais pas exactement sûr de ce que les développeurs Mac qui n'a jouer avec de l'ARC trucs dans leurs Applications Mac sont censé faire maintenant....

Fichier Radar Rapports. Attendre 4.3? refaire de l'application? Modifier l' .xcode XML manuellement? Pas sûr.

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X